I think >> > >> > I can miss a few, except for ksnapshot. Is this a wrong dependency? >> >> Yes, the kdegraphics metapackage needs to switch from ksnapshot to >> kde-spectacle. As people pointed out already, ksnapshot is no more >> developed, and instead there's spectacle (called kde-spectacle in Debian >> for naming issues) which does what ksnapshot did and more. >> >> I'm going to upload soon a new version of meta-kde, so the update won't >> cause the packages to be uninstalled. > > The only thing I miss from kde-spectacle is simply numbering screenshots. The Spectacle preferences says "If a file with this name already exists, a serial number will be appended to the filename. For example, if the filename is "Screenshot", and "Screenshot.png" already exist, the image will be saved as "Screenshot-1.png". -- Sami Erjomaa
